Genetic diversity in german and European populations: looking for substructures and genetic patterns.
Gesundheitswesen (Bundesverband der Arzte des Offentlichen Gesundheitsdienstes (Germany)) - 1 Aug 2005
Lamina C, Steffens M, Mueller J, Lohmussaar E, Meitinger T, Wichmann H E
Abstract excerpt
A classical case-control study is a powerful and cost-efficient approach to detect association of genetic markers with complex disease phenotypes. However, only a small fraction of significant association results has been replicated by other studies. Undetected genetic substructures in the population may be one of the reasons for spurious or biased results. The German "Genomic Control" study aims at detecting...
